Output dfd6242faacaf5e79d928acde3374d3bbc63f39b203899f3b36b19f1074c73e2:1

value
27260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1006b03ab29f1285f1f343fd41941c88ed536510 OP_EQUAL
address
339kkL9TgsXm3uzAAWCzmzaEWikP2Vc25v
transaction
dfd6242faacaf5e79d928acde3374d3bbc63f39b203899f3b36b19f1074c73e2
confirmations
280104
spent
true